Chemical inventory may initially seem daunting, but there are substantial long-term benefits in keeping track of what is in your laboratory. A robust chemical inventory system is crucial for most laboratories and ensures compliance with key regulatory requirements including OSHA’s Hazard Communication Standard and the EPA’s Toxic Substances Control Act. 

How to Build an Effective Chemical Inventory System

An effective inventory system also works to promote operational efficiencies of laboratories by reducing the risk of errors, minimizing waste, avoiding over-purchasing, and keeping real-time tabs on your chemical pantry. Most importantly, researchers will have quick access to vital information in case of accidents in the laboratory, thereby mitigating risks and ensuring ample preparation for emergencies.
